Battery Replacement

The Lexus Smart Key has a fantastic feature that allows you to lock or unlock your car's doors as well as open the trunk and start the motor without having to insert the key. The only drawback is that it uses an battery, and with time, it will eventually be depleted of power and need a replacement.

It's important to know that you can change the battery of the Lexus keyfob at home, or any repair shop for auto repairs nearby. The first step is removing the emergency key blade made of metal from the key fob. The release button is located on the left side of your key fob. After you have removed the metal blade employ a flathead to gently break the fob at the edge. Then, you are able to remove the old CR2032 battery and insert another one in its place. Make sure that the positive (+) face of the battery is facing up.

Smart Access Key Battery

Many new Lexus models come with a Smart Access Key that allows users to lock and unlock their vehicle from an extended distance. However, as time passes, the battery inside this key begins to dwindle and will require to be replaced. This is a relatively easy process and can be done by a local locksmith in Lake Elsinore.

Keep your key fob no more than three feet from electronic devices that emit magnetic waves. This includes TVs and laptops. It's also a good idea to turn on the key fob's power-saving mode when it's not being used. To do so, press and hold the LOCK button as well as the UNLOCK button two times. The indicator's electronic light will flash four times to indicate that it has been put into battery-saving mode. To resume using Smart Access and push-button start simply press any button on the key fob.

To replace the battery to replace the battery, first press the release button on the side. Then, you can remove the mechanical emergency keys that are stored inside the. Once the old battery is removed, place a brand new CR2032 lithium coin cell battery in the slot with the positive (+) side facing up. Slide the metal emergency key in place and then snap the cover on the fob.

Smart Access Key Programming

Most Lexus cars come with an electronic key system that replaces traditional metal car keys. You need to replace the key fob if you lose it or break it. You can purchase a replacement at your local auto parts store or through an automotive locksmith. The process takes about 10 to 30 minutes. The process includes installing the key and programming it to ensure that it can work with your vehicle. You can also find several "at your own risk" tutorials online for programming your own smart key, however this isn't advised as it could cause further problems with your vehicle.

It is important to remember that the smart key can only have a certain number of keys that are registered in the ECU at any given moment. If you have multiple keys that are registered in the vehicle, you will need to erase them before adding the new key. This can be done by following the steps in the Lexus owner's manual.
